Doesn't sound to me like VW is looking to bail. It looks like they need cash for the next wave(s) of station expansion, and they want someone else to put skin in the game alongside them. Ideally it will be several auto manufacturers who invest, so that it's not all dependent on just one or two. IONITY in Europe is structured that way, with investments from BMW, Daimler, Ford, Hyundai, and VW. Hyundai was the last to join in Nov 2020. I would love to see

https://insideevs.com/news/518598/rumor-volkswagen-coinvestor-electrify-america/

Hyundai, Ford, and Jeep have partnered with EA in various ways, but obviously have not invested in it directly. GM partnered with EVGo, but there are plenty of stories about how that relationship is on thin ice because EVGo is well behind their required pace of installation of new higher-speed chargers. Nissan has partnered with (or maybe even invested in) EVGo. The ideal would probably be for Hyundai, Ford, and Jeep to invest what VW's looking for with EA and for GM and Nissan to invest heavily in EVGo so we have 2 well-funded networks tied to large manufacturers who are highly motivated to keep the networks alive. (EDIT: Daimler has invested $82 million in Chargepoint, so that's a third network with manufacturer investment.)

Also an interesting quote that Electrek got from EA in a request for comment about the new investor reports:

“Electrify America, the largest open DC fast charging network in the U.S., is accelerating the rate of charging infrastructure installations across the U.S., currently with more than 630 charging stations and over 2,700 individuals chargers at those stations. We are focused on having about 800 stations and 3,500 chargers by the end of 2021. We have nothing to share beyond those plans.”
I'm sure those numbers have been mentioned before, but I think it's worth highlighting again how quickly EA is still expanding. They're saying they will add ~170 stations and ~800 chargers (average of ~4.7 chargers/station) before the end of THIS YEAR. That's still pretty aggressive growth. I don't think they've shared many plans beyond that wave of expansion this year, but it looks like maybe the plans will be at least somewhat contingent on an infusion of cash from another investor.

One of the cool things that becomes apparent when looking at combination of RAN and EA is that Rivian seems to have put some effort in to supplement EA and generally isn't planning on stations in the same places that EA is. Which I suspect makes their build out even more aggressive since they may have to fight for new backbone installations to get the power where they need vs piggybacking on EA and Tesla.

The second problem is, I most often didn't see ABRP used for route planning. At least not in the Bolt EV groups. As I said, it was most often used as a tool to denigrate or dismiss the Bolt EV (i.e., a marketing and sales tool). "You can't make this trip because ABRP says...." or "See how much slower or more expensive it is to travel in a Bolt EV because ABRP says...." At that point, when ABRP is no longer being used as a route planning tool, a 15% to 20% conservative margin of error is misleading and harmful.
I have a 2017 Bolt and also have not been using ABRP, although I have downloaded it and played around. So back in January I drove my Bolt to Flagstaff from Phoenix, starting out with less than a full charge and having to use the heater. I was able to make it to Flagstaff with 5% battery left, certainly would have had more margin if I had fully charged.

So I am now planning a trip to the Grand Canyon in my Mach E, but for fun I planned it in my Bolt using ABRP. It tells me I cannot get to Flagstaff in my Bolt, even starting with a full charge. There is also an EA station about 30 miles into the trip, where I suppose I could top off a bit, but it ignores that. Do I trust it? Of course not, since I have already made that trip previously.

My GM app tells me I can make the trip starting out at 90% charge and ending up with 8% charge in Flagstaff, which actually is pretty close to the trip I did in January.

Conversely, I drove to a hike the other day with my ID.4. ABRP nailed my arrival SOC at both the TH and then back home within 1%. When we left the TH at 28% and put the route home for fun in the car's nav, it said I wouldn't make it home and there was no charging available. Made it with 20% SOC.

I've found ABRP quite accurate, and very helpful in estimating energy consumption for various conditions (like going up to a mountain). It's definitely not perfect, but it can be a useful learning tool, and supplement to other apps.
